Key Components of Material Handling Systems

The material handling system for soybean protein powder typically includes several key components. These components work together to ensure the safe and efficient transport of the powder. Feeders are responsible for controlling the flow rate of the powder, providing a consistent feed to the conveyor system. Conveyors, such as screw or pneumatic types, transport the powder from one location to another. Storage silos are used to store large quantities of the powder, offering a stable environment. Processing units, like mixers or blenders, may also be integrated into the system depending on the final application.

Design Principles for Efficient Handling

The design of soybean protein powder handling equipment must prioritize several critical factors. First, the equipment must be designed to prevent clogging and blockages, which are common issues with fine powders. This is achieved through smooth surfaces, appropriate slope angles, and suitable material selection for components. Second, dust generation and proper ventilation are crucial. Soybean protein powder is fine and can become airborne, posing health and safety risks. Therefore, dust collection systems and adequate ventilation are essential. Third, the equipment must be easy to clean and maintain. The fine powder can accumulate in crevices, making cleaning challenging. Features like easy-to-remove parts, CIP (Clean-in-Place) systems, and smooth surfaces facilitate maintenance.

Types of Conveyors

Conveyors are a key part of the handling system, and different types are used based on the application. Screw conveyors are widely used due to their simplicity and effectiveness in handling fine powders. They consist of a rotating screw inside a tube, moving the powder along the conveyor. Pneumatic conveyors, or air conveyors, use compressed air to transport the powder through a pipeline, ideal for long-distance transport. Belt conveyors are another option but are more suitable for larger particles or bulk materials. For fine soybean protein powder, screw or pneumatic conveyors are preferred to avoid blockages.

Feeder Design

Feeders control the flow rate of the powder and are critical for consistent operation. Types include vibratory feeders, rotary valves, and screw feeders. Vibratory feeders use vibration to move the powder along a trough, ensuring a smooth flow. Rotary valves, or rotary airlocks, control the flow from storage silos to the conveyor. Screw feeders use a rotating screw for smaller-scale transport. The choice depends on the powder's characteristics and application, with vibratory feeders often used for fine powders to maintain consistency.

Storage Silo Considerations

Storage silos hold large quantities of soybean protein powder and must be designed for durability and safety. Constructed from stainless steel or corrosion-resistant materials, they prevent contamination. The conical or cylindrical shape, with a conical bottom, facilitates powder discharge. Proper ventilation and dust collection systems are essential to prevent dust accumulation and ensure safety.
